About Italian sausage link

Italian sausage links are a flavorful staple in Italian cuisine, made from ground pork seasoned with a blend of herbs and spices like fennel, garlic, and paprika. Available in sweet or spicy varieties, they bring a distinctive taste to pasta dishes, sandwiches, and grills. Nutritionally, Italian sausage is a good source of protein and B vitamins, which support energy metabolism and muscle maintenance. However, it is typically high in saturated fat and sodium, which should be consumed in moderation for a balanced diet. Some versions may include added sugars or preservatives, so checking the ingredient list is key. For a lighter option, look for leaner sausage varieties or those made with turkey or chicken. Enjoyed in moderation and paired with vegetables or whole grains, Italian sausage can add rich flavor and depth to your meals.
